Why the map you grew up with disagrees

On a Mercator map, area grows with distance from the equator. Pitcairn Islands sits at about 24°S and is stretched to 1.21× its true area; Saint Lucia at 14° N is stretched to 1.06×. Here the two are distorted about the same amount, so Mercator gets this pair roughly right. The figure above uses the Equal Earth projection, where every square kilometre is drawn the same size.
